What does the Tripp Lite AVS5D do?
The AVS5D is an automatic voltage switch that protects connected appliances from high voltages, low voltages (including brownouts), power surges, spikes and lightning. It disconnects equipment when voltage or load exceeds set limits and automatically reconnects when power stabilizes (except after an overload which requires a manual reset).
How do I set the overvoltage protection level?
Press and hold F1 for 3 seconds to enter settings mode. The display will show E-0. Press F1 repeatedly until E-2 appears (overvoltage protection). Press F2 to select it, then press F2 to adjust the value (each press changes by 5 V). Press F1 to confirm. Wait 10 seconds to save and exit.
How do I reset the AVS5D after an overload?
After an overload fault (P-H flashing), the unit does not reset automatically. You must power cycle the unit: unplug it from the wall outlet, wait a few seconds, then plug it back in. The delay countdown will begin and normal operation will resume.
What is the startup delay and can it be changed?
The startup delay is a countdown (default 6 seconds) before the AVS5D supplies power to your equipment, ensuring voltage stability. It can be adjusted from 6 to 120 seconds in 6-second increments via setting E-0. Note: changing the delay requires a power cycle to take effect.
What does the digital display show?
During normal operation, the display shows the output voltage (with Voltage LED on) or the load in watts (with Load LED on). You can toggle between them by pressing F2 briefly. The display also shows status codes like U-H (overvoltage), U-L (undervoltage), and P-H (overload) when faults occur.
What level of surge protection does the AVS5D provide?
The AVS5D offers 190 Joules of energy absorption, a peak surge current of 4500 A (8/20 µs waveform), and a response time of 10 nanoseconds. This protects against most common power surges and spikes.
Can I use the AVS5D with sensitive electronics like computers?
Yes, the AVS5D is suitable for computers and other sensitive electronics as it provides both voltage regulation (disconnection during abnormal voltages) and surge protection. However, do not use it with devices that require continuous power (e.g., life support equipment) since it will cut power during faults.
What is the warranty period for the Tripp Lite AVS5D?
The AVS5D is covered by a 7-Year Limited Warranty. Tripp Lite will repair or replace defective products free of charge. To obtain service, you need an RMA number and must return the product with proof of purchase and prepaid shipping.
What are the dimensions and weight of the AVS5D?
The AVS5D measures 110 x 65 x 85 mm (height x width x depth) and weighs 0.15 kg. It is compact and designed for direct wall outlet installation.
How do I restore factory default settings?
Enter settings mode by pressing and holding F1 for 3 seconds. Press F1 until E-5 is displayed. Press F2 to select it, then press F1 to confirm. The unit will restore defaults, reset, and begin the startup countdown.

Introduction

The AVS5D is a 5 amp rated automatic voltage switch that protects appliances from high voltages, low voltages (including brownouts), power surges, spikes and lighting. It does this by switching off connected equipment if the power flowing to it goes outside preset limits, and will reconnect automatically when power returns to normal (except in the case of an overload condition). There will be a delay before the reconnection to ensure power stability.

Product Overview

230 VOLTAGE LOAD F1 F2 Tripp-LITE 1 2 3 4 5 6 7

1 BS 1363 Plug Connects to wall outlet.
2 BS 1363 Outlet Connects to appliance plug.
3 F1 & F2 Program Buttons Using the two buttons, you can set the output over/under voltage, overload protection value, browse settable parameters and change digital display mode. During normal operation, you can press F2 to display the load. After 3 seconds, the switch returns to the voltage display.
5 Voltage LED Illuminates when the digital display shows voltage.
6 Load LED Illuminates when the digital display shows the load in watts.

Product Overview

7 Digital Display Shows voltage, wattage, status and settings.

A) U-H Output Overvoltage Protection Status

When output voltage exceeds the preset limit and doesn't return to within the preset limits after 1 second, your equipment will be disconnected by the switch. U-H will flash on the display every .5 seconds as long as the overvoltage condition exists.

B) U-L Output Undervoltage Protection Status

When output voltage goes lower than the preset limit and doesn't return to within the preset limits after 1 second, your equipment will be disconnected by the switch. U-L will flash on the display every .5 seconds as long as the undervoltage condition exists.

C) P-H Overload Protection Status

When the load exceeds the preset range (nominally 110-120%) and lasts longer than 6 seconds (within this 6 seconds no action will be taken by the AVS5D), the switch will disconnect from power. P-H will flash on the display every .5 seconds as long as the overload condition exists.

When the load exceeds the preset range (nominally 150%) and lasts longer than 1 second, the switch will disconnect from power. P-H will flash on the display every .5 seconds as long as the overload condition exists.

Overload Faults - You must power cycle the unit to restore the current flow. The unit does not reset automatically from this type of fault.

D) Start Up Delay

When first powered up, the unit will count down a set number of seconds (default is 6) before monitoring voltage.

E) Parameter Setting Codes

E-0 Delay setting
E-1 Undervoltage protection value setting
E-2 Overvoltage protection value setting
E-3 Overload protection value setting
E-4 Displays output voltage or loading power value after startup (U = voltage, P = watts)
E-5 Restores default settings

Note: The code and value flash alternately every second while changing settings.

Installation & Operation

Tripp Lite AVS5D - Installation & Operation - 1

Caution: Don't use this switch with any device that needs to be continually powered, as the switch is designed to cut power when unstable voltages occur.

1) Plug switch into outlet and plug in appliances.

2) After the switch is plugged in, it will display a 6 second countdown (default) before supplying power to your appliance and showing the voltage on the Digital Display.

3) If the default settings aren't appropriate for your situation, you can change them by following the procedure below.

Notes:

• We strongly recommend you use the default settings to ensure safe operation of the switch.

- It's possible to adjust the parameters at any time. Changing the delay setting requires a power cycle for the new delay to take effect.

Changing Settings

Press and hold F1 for three seconds to enter settings mode.

Setting Codes: E-0 will be displayed.

(See Switch Settings chart for code explanations)

Tripp Lite AVS5D - Changing Settings - 1

flowchart
graph TD
    A["Press F1 to cycle through the available codes."] --> B["Press F2 to select the code you wish to change."]
    B --> C["Press F2 to adjust the value (the code and value will flash alternately every second). Each value changes by a certain increment every time you press F2 (See Switch Settings chart)."]
    C --> D["Press F1 to confirm the value."]

Don't press anything for 10 seconds to exit and save the settings.

Switch Settings

CodeItem DefaultSettable Range Increment# of Increments
E-0Delay Setting 6 seconds 6-120 seconds6 seconds 20
E-1Undervoltage Protection 180V 120V-200V 5V 16
E-2Overvoltage Protection 255V 210V-270V 5V 12
E-3Overload Protection700W100W-1000W150W
E-4Digital DisplayShows output voltage or loading power value after startup (U= voltage, P= watts)
E-5Restore DefaultsRestores all default settings. Unit will display defaults once confirmed, then reset and count down.

Specifications

Current Rating 5 amps

Voltage Rating 230V (220-240V)

Frequency 50/60 Hz

Response Time Over/undervoltage 1 second

Reflex Voltage Over/undervoltage 5\~10V

Spike/Surge Protection (Joules) 190J

Spike/Surge Protection (Amps) 4500KA (8/20us)

Spike/Surge Protection (Response Time) 10 nanoseconds

Dimensions (HxWxD) 110x65x85 mm

Weight .15 kg
